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Lake to Oxenholme Lake District start from as little as £82.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lake to Oxenholme Lake District start from £144.70 one way, or £218.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lake to Oxenholme Lake District are available for £157.00 one way, or £310.80 return

Facilities and Amenities at Lake Train Station

When visiting Lake Train Station, travelers should be aware that it operates with a minimalist setup. There is no ticket office or ticket machines on-site, and while it lacks some typical station amenities, it compensates with essential accessibility options like a ramp for train access and an induction loop for hearing aid users. Despite the absence of waiting lounges, accessible toilets, or refreshment facilities, you will find CCTV for security and a seating area to make your short wait more comfortable. For any assistance while at the station, customer help points are available, and the staff on the train are there to help with boarding and alighting.

Seamless Transportation Links

For those needing to navigate onward from Lake, there are several transport options at your disposal. During times of railway work or disruptions, rail replacement buses are conveniently located by local landmarks such as the Pet Doctors or Lake Fish Bar. Although, perhaps surprisingly, there is no direct taxi rank or car hire service linked with the station. If you are planning a journey by bus, printable resources are available to facilitate your travel from Lake to neighboring regions.

Facilities and Amenities

The facilities at Oxenholme Lake District are designed to cater to a wide range of passenger needs. With a fully operational ticket office open from early morning until late evening throughout the week, travelers can purchase and collect tickets with ease. The station is equipped with ticket machines, including accessible options for those with specific needs. For online ticket collectors, the convenience doesn't stop there – tickets bought online can be easily retrieved from the ticket machines.

Oxenholme Lake District ensures accessibility for all passengers, offering step-free access predominantly throughout the station. While the access to Platforms 2 and 3 includes a steep ramp, helpful staff assistance is available during generous service hours every day. This accessibility commitment is further supported by facilities like heated waiting rooms and accessible toilets, providing comfort and convenience for every traveler.

For those planning a longer stay, Avanti West Coast operates a 24-hour car park, with spaces available for both daily and long-term use. As well as traditional refreshment options at Café Express on Platforms 2 and 3, shops are available, adding a touch of convenience before your journey continues.

Transport Connections

The ease of onward travel is central to the experience at Oxenholme Lake District station. If bus travel suits your needs, the station offers details in a printable guide on connecting services that can be accessed here. For immediate travel needs upon arrival, taxi services are conveniently located just outside the ticket office. Additionally, rail replacement services, when needed, are efficiently organized at the station's front.
